Bill Summary
A BILL To amend the Investor Protection and Securities Reform Act of 2010 to provide grants to States for enhanced protection of senior investors and senior policyholders, and for other purposes.
AI Summary
This bill amends the Investor Protection and Securities Reform Act of 2010 to provide grants to state securities commissions and insurance departments (referred to as "eligible entities") for enhanced protection of senior investors and policyholders. The bill establishes a task force within the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) to administer the grant program, which allows eligible entities to use the funds to hire staff, fund technology and training, provide educational materials, develop plans to combat senior financial fraud, and enhance state laws to protect seniors. The bill sets a maximum grant amount of $500,000 per eligible entity and authorizes $10 million in annual appropriations for the program from 2023 to 2028.
